How to Fix a Leaky Shower
No property owner would certainly like a dripping shower in their restroom. If you do not want your water expenses to skyrocket, you've obtained to the source of your leaking shower and also fix it.

Tidy up the Piping


Don't neglect to cleanse the pipes before you put every little thing back with each other. You should wash the pipes and also valves thoroughly to ensure smooth capability. You can make use of a cleansing remedy constructed of warm distilled vinegar thinned down in some water. This can secure debris as well as signs of deterioration. After this, the valves will certainly be a lot easier to use due to the fact that water will stream easily.

Unclog the Showerhead Holes


Showerhead holes commonly clog up, specifically if you have actually obtained a difficult water source that has a lot of sedimentation. Frequently, obstruct holes result in a leaking shower. As a result, the water will find one more means to run away and leakage from various other components of the showerhead.

Change What's Worse for Wear


After your showerhead aesthetic inspection, change the components that look worse for wear. The rubber washing machine is the most common wrongdoer of dripping showerheads. With a malfunctioning rubber washer, water will certainly always get away. Fortunately, you can acquire a replacement washing machine in the equipment as well as area it back to solve the problem. You can buy a new showerhead. There are several budget-friendly components online as a replacement.

Check Out the Piping Connectors


If you have actually tried your best to take care of the showerhead, but the leak is still there, have a look at the links. Take a look at the part where the showerhead fulfills your water supply. This is a very usual area where leaks take place. Keep in mind, maintain the primary shutoff shut down prior to checking out the leakage resource. Examine if the leak is originating from the chilly or warm water pipe by feeling it with your fingers. As soon as you have actually identified where the concern is, you can repair the proper shutoffs. You can additionally replace the seals in between the pipes and also the shower unit to regulate the leakage.

Try to Repair the Showerhead


The first thing you have to do is attempt your finest to repair the showerhead. Beginning by closing the main water valve to avoid swamping your home. When that's done, you can unscrew the showerhead. Assess the adhering to for deterioration:
  • Problem of head

  • Check the O-ring threads

  • Examine the plastic washing machine

    Showers are a quick, easy, and energy-efficient way to get clean and save money while doing so. The amount of water used during a shower can vary dramatically but showers typically use less water than bathtubs. The average shower uses 17 gallons of water compared to the 24 gallons used in your everyday bath.


    Walk-in showers are spacious yet flexible for most remodeling projects, luxurious, and provide accessibility to all. Showers, in general, are easy to keep clean due to stain and moisture-resistant tiles. Walk-in showers provide a wide range of possibilities because they’re beautiful in any bathroom, no matter what style.


    Showers have been the right choice for those with smaller bathrooms because they provide an additional seven percent of floor space that could make a surprisingly big difference in the layout of your restroom.


    Elderly and disabled individuals prefer curbless walk-in showers because they are easier to enter and exit, and could offer a place to sit and railings for safety and ease.     Shower Installation Costs


    According to the data reported by Homeowners in 2021, the average costs of installing a new shower are $5,115, with prices ranging from $2,128 and $8,299. The total amount you’ll pay depends on the size, style, and materials used.


    Shower stall kits provide flexible, low-cost options that cat fit into corners and old bathtub alcoves. They’re normally made of acrylic or fiberglass, include pre-made sides, a skid-proof floor pan with curbs and a drain hole, and a hinged glass door. Extras like built-in seats and shelves for bath products can add to your total costs, which may range between $200-$2000.


    Replacing your shower could cost anywhere between $1,200 to $6,350, including removal of the old unit. Those who find that they need to replace the pipes or relocate them will have to pay additional costs.
